Nawagarh

Nawagarh is a Town and Tehsil in Janjgir Champa District of Chhattisgarh. In India, a tehsil is a sub-division of a district that is responsible for the administration and revenue collection of a particular area within the district. It is an important part of the local governance structure, and plays a crucial role in the development and administration of its local community.

According to Census 2011, the sub-district code of Nawagarh Block (CD) is 03280. The total area of Nawagarh Tehsil is 378 km², which includes 351.40 km² of rural area and 26.28 km² of urban area. Nawagarh has a sex ratio of approximately 973 females per 1,000 males.

Population of Nawagarh Tehsil

The population profile of Nawagarh Tehsil offers a deeper understanding of how people are settled across its rural and urban parts. The following sections provide key insights into total population, household distribution, literacy, and age demographics — data that plays a vital role in planning development work and allocating public resources effectively.

Basic Population Details

This section offers a snapshot of Nawagarh Tehsil's population composition, including male-female ratio, child population, and how literacy levels vary between villages and towns.

Particulars Total Rural Urban
Total Population 1,56,947 1,39,122 17,825
Male Population 79,514 70,459 9,055
Female Population 77,433 68,663 8,770
Child Population (Age 0–6) 22,909 20,468 2,441
Male Child Population (Age 0–6) 11,707 10,475 1,232
Female Child Population (Age 0–6) 11,202 9,993 1,209
Literate Population 98,040 86,060 11,980
Literate Male Population 57,818 50,914 6,904
Literate Female Population 40,222 35,146 5,076
Illiterate Population 58,907 53,062 5,845
Illiterate Male Population 21,696 19,545 2,151
Illiterate Female Population 37,211 33,517 3,694
Total Households 31,817 28,044 3,773

Here’s a simplified summary based on Census 2011 stats:

  • Total population of Nawagarh Tehsil is around 1,56,947 people. This includes 79,514 males and 77,433 females. Rural population is about 1,39,122 (70,459 males and 68,663 females), while urban population is nearly 17,825 (9,055 males and 8,770 females).
  • Children aged 0–6 years make up about 22,909 of the population, with 11,707 boys and 11,202 girls. Rural areas have 20,468 children, and urban areas have about 2,441 children in this age group.
  • There are approximately 98,040 literate people in Nawagarh Tehsil, including 57,818 literate males and 40,222 literate females. Literacy in rural areas includes 86,060 individuals and urban literacy covers around 11,980 people.
  • About 58,907 people in Nawagarh Tehsil are not literate, including 21,696 males and 37,211 females. Rural areas include 53,062 non-literate people, while urban areas have nearly 5,845 individuals.
  • The tehsil has around 31,817 households, with 28,044 in villages and 3,773 in towns.

Social Structure and Density

This section offers a snapshot of social structure in Nawagarh Tehsil, highlighting the SC and ST population across rural and urban areas, as well as how densely people live in different parts of the region.

Particulars Total Rural Urban
Total SC Population 37,134 34,595 2,539
SC Male Population 18,696 17,426 1,270
SC Female Population 18,438 17,169 1,269
Total ST Population 3,118 2,629 489
ST Male Population 1,557 1,312 245
ST Female Population 1,561 1,317 244
Population Density 416 / km² 396 / km² 678 / km²

Here’s a simplified summary based on Census 2011 stats:

  • Scheduled Caste (SC) population in Nawagarh Tehsil is approximately 37,134 people, including 18,696 males and 18,438 females. Around 34,595 people live in rural parts. Nearly 2,539 people reside in urban areas.
  • Scheduled Tribe (ST) population in Nawagarh Tehsil is about 3,118 people, including 1,557 males and 1,561 females. Around 2,629 live in villages or rural parts. Nearly 489 live in towns or urban regions.
  • In terms of density, overall population density is around 416 people per square kilometre, rural areas have about 396 people per sq. km, urban areas record nearly 678 people per sq. km.
